In NHL 09, management isn't just about trades; it's about reputation. The "Be A GM" mode (sometimes abbreviated as MGT in strategy guides) introduced several deep mechanics: nhl 09 mgt

The offseason began with the draft. You picked in order based on your previous season's standings, though trades could change your draft capital. If your scouts did their job well, you had the intel needed to select players with high "potential" ratings. These were the cornerstones of your future dynasty, but they needed time, patience, and proper training to reach their ceilings.

The true rhythm of "NHL 09 MGT" was the annual cycle. Managing a team wasn't a straight line; it was a circle of events that repeated each year.
